Noble launched the M15 as a concept first in 2006. It was powered by a twin-turbocharged V6 engine with a maximum output of 455 hp and 455lb/ft of torque. But now rumors say that the production version will be powered by the same V8 engine as the Volvo XC90.

If in the XC90, the 4.4 liter V8 engine produces 311 hp, in the M15, with a couple of turbochargers it will boost power to around 650bhp. With a weight of 1100kg, the M15 is 30% stiffer than the M12 thanks and has better weight distribution despite the larger engine.

The M15 Concept accelerates from 0-60mph in less than 3.3 seconds and 10 100mph in less than 8s and hits a top speed of 200 mph. The production version is expected to be priced at around £104,000.
